City vs Highway Performance

The 2024 Kia EV9 Dual Motor Electric Light delivers 104 MPG in city driving conditions and 91 MPG on the highway. This split reveals the vehicle’s strengths in urban environments where regenerative braking captures energy during frequent stops and deceleration. City driving at lower speeds also allows the dual motors to operate at peak efficiency without overworking to maintain highway velocities.

Highway performance at 91 MPG is still exceptional for a three-row electric SUV, though naturally lower than city ratings. At sustained highway speeds, the vehicle experiences greater aerodynamic drag and continuous motor output, which explains the 13 MPG efficiency difference. Drivers who frequently commute on highways should expect consumption closer to the 91 MPG rating, while those primarily navigating city streets and suburban roads will see results closer to the 104 MPG city figure.

Real-World MPG Expectations

While EPA ratings provide standardized benchmarks, real-world efficiency depends on driving habits, climate conditions, and road terrain. Most 2024 Kia EV9 Dual Motor Electric Light owners report achieving results within 5-10 percent of the EPA combined 98 MPG rating under normal driving conditions. Cold weather can reduce efficiency by 10-20 percent due to battery performance and increased heating demands, while mild climates may exceed EPA estimates.

To maximize real-world efficiency, maintain steady speeds on highways, avoid rapid acceleration from stops, and utilize regenerative braking by coasting when possible. Proper tire pressure, regular maintenance, and pre-conditioning the cabin while plugged in all contribute to optimal efficiency. Lighter loads and aerodynamic driving styles also help achieve the most favorable fuel economy results.

Tips to Maximize Efficiency

  • Utilize Regenerative Braking: Allow the vehicle to coast and brake gently to recover kinetic energy, especially in city driving where frequent stops occur.
  • Maintain Optimal Tire Pressure: Check tire pressure monthly and inflate to the recommended PSI, as underinflated tires increase rolling resistance and reduce efficiency.
  • Plan Efficient Routes: Minimize aggressive acceleration and high-speed driving by selecting routes with steady traffic flow and moderate speed limits.
  • Precondition While Charging: Heat or cool the cabin while connected to power rather than draining battery charge for climate control.
  • Monitor Driving Patterns: Use the vehicle’s efficiency display to track real-time MPG and adjust driving behavior accordingly.

Frequently Asked Questions

Q: Is the 98 MPG rating the same as gasoline MPG? A: No. Electric vehicles use MPGe (miles per gallon equivalent), which measures energy efficiency differently than gasoline combustion. The EPA defines one gallon gasoline equivalent as 33.7 kilowatt-hours of electricity.

Q: What affects the 2024 Kia EV9 Dual Motor Electric Light’s real-world efficiency? A: Battery temperature, driving speed, terrain elevation, passenger weight, and weather conditions all influence actual efficiency. Cold temperatures particularly impact range and efficiency due to battery chemistry changes.

Q: How does the dual motor system affect fuel economy? A: Dual motors enable all-wheel-drive performance and independent torque distribution, which can slightly reduce efficiency compared to single-motor vehicles but provide superior traction and handling characteristics.
